Bush campaign website hacked

Wonder what the OS was
Wednesday, 27 October 2004, 08:46
US PRESIDENT George W. Bush's official re-election website was hacked and down for some hours yesterday.

Visitors to www.georgewbush.com were greeted with an error message.

Campaign organisers told Reuters that the site was shut down after hackers got to it. They were not saying what the hackers actually did before the press noticed the lack of a leader's site. However one organiser hinted that it was a denial of service attack.

While Steve Jobs is advising Bush's rival John Kerry, it is not clear if the Bush web presence was being run on Microsoft software or if it was patched. ยต
